Open Bug 736071 Opened 12 years ago Updated 2 years ago

Use anonymous relations to set aria label on calendar view items

Categories

(Calendar :: Calendar Frontend, defect)

defect

Tracking

(Not tracked)

People

(Reporter: Fallen, Unassigned, Mentored)

Details

(Keywords: access, good-first-bug, Whiteboard: [lang=xul])

Please see bug 421242 comment 1 for a full description. Fixing this bug might improve accessibility in the calendar views.

Fixing this bug requires knowledge about XUL and XBL, if you know about the ARIA standard its a bonus.
Hi Fallen 

I want to try fix this, can you assign this to me? Thanks.
Sure thing :-) You should find most information you need in the referenced bug, also its initial comment. Another thing that helps, the DOM inspector has an "accessible view" in the dropdown on the top of the left panel. This tells you how a screen reader would see the application.
Assignee: nobody → liuweiran.nus
Status: NEW → ASSIGNED
Thank you :) And could you please take a look at my second patch at Bug 694024

(In reply to Philipp Kewisch [:Fallen] from comment #2)
> Sure thing :-) You should find most information you need in the referenced
> bug, also its initial comment. Another thing that helps, the DOM inspector
> has an "accessible view" in the dropdown on the top of the left panel. This
> tells you how a screen reader would see the application.
Can you confirm that you're still working on this bug?
Flags: needinfo?(liuweiran.nus)
Assignee: liuweiran.nus → nobody
Status: ASSIGNED → NEW
Flags: needinfo?(liuweiran.nus)
Mentor: philipp
Whiteboard: [good first bug][mentor=Fallen][lang=xul] → [good first bug][lang=xul]
Keywords: good-first-bug
Whiteboard: [good first bug][lang=xul] → [lang=xul]
No longer blocks: 431076
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.